We are Tribology and surface science group within ASML Design & Engineering. We deliver tribology and surface science expertise to enable robust wafer clamping solutions and scanner roadmap. We continue building/securing tribology and surface science knowledge by linking various business partners, external knowledge centers and academic partners.

Role and responsibilities

You will actively help the D&E projects with their challenges in the field of tribology and with expanding ASML's tribology competence as a whole. Your main responsibilities can include:

  • Performing investigations for the project in the field of tribology (testing, calculations, data analysis).
  • Creation and validation of new concepts with a goal to improve ASML product performance.
  • Advice design engineers on material choices to fulfil tribology contact requirements.
  • Support senior experts with hands on testing and analysis work.

Education and experience

Technical University PhD/Master (with 3-7 years of experience) in Physics, Chemistry or Mechanical/Materials Engineering with expertise in tribology and surface interactions. Knowledge or working experience in field of:

  • Friction mechanisms (micro, nanoscale).
  • Nanoscale wear mechanisms.
  • Knowledge of tribometers, nanoindenters, other surface mechanical tooling.
  • Surface characterization and
  • Friction phenomena in mechanical systems.
  • MATLAB knowledge (is a must).
  • Finite element method (FEM)preferred.
  • Electrostatics.
  • Failure modes & analysis.
